Several online birth control delivery services can be a convenient and discreet way to access contraception. Here are some of the best options, with a brief explanation of what makes them stand out:
-
Nurx: Nurx is a popular choice because it offers a wide range of birth control methods, including the pill, patch, ring, and even the shot. They have a straightforward online platform where you can consult with a healthcare provider, get a prescription, and have your birth control delivered to your door. They also handle insurance and offer competitive out-of-pocket pricing.
-
Planned Parenthood Direct: If you're looking for a reliable and established provider, Planned Parenthood Direct is an excellent option. They offer a variety of birth control methods through their app, including the pill, patch, and ring. They prioritize accessible reproductive healthcare and often have lower costs, especially for those without insurance. You can get prescriptions and have them mailed to you.
-
CVS Pharmacy / Walgreens Pharmacy: Major pharmacy chains like CVS and Walgreens have expanded their online offerings to include birth control delivery. If you already get prescriptions filled at one of these pharmacies, it can be very convenient to stick with them. They offer a good selection of pills and sometimes other methods, and you can often get same-day or next-day delivery options.
-
Lemonaid Health: Lemonaid Health provides a comprehensive approach to women's health, including birth control. Their service involves an online consultation with a doctor or nurse practitioner, followed by a prescription and delivery of your chosen method. They are known for their transparent pricing and good customer service.
-
Hers: While Hers has a broader focus on women's health, they are a strong contender for birth control delivery. They offer a variety of pills and have a user-friendly online platform for consultations and ordering. They also provide other reproductive health services, which can be convenient if you need more than just birth control.
When choosing a service, consider factors like the variety of birth control methods offered, pricing (with and without insurance), delivery speed, and the ease of their online platform and customer support. It's always a good idea to check with your insurance provider to see which services they cover.
